Introduction to Pascal

Pascal, a structured programming language, holds a significant place in computer science history. Developed by Niklaus Wirth in the early 1970s, it was designed to encourage good programming practices and readability. While not as widely used as languages like Python or Java today, understanding Pascal offers valuable insights into programming fundamentals. Pascal's influence can still be seen in many modern languages.

Key Features of Pascal

Pascal's structure emphasizes clarity and organization. This is achieved through several key features:

Structured Programming

Pascal strongly promotes structured programming, using procedures and functions to break down complex tasks into smaller, manageable modules. This modularity improves code readability and maintainability.

Data Types

Pascal features a rich set of data types, including integers, real numbers, characters, booleans, and arrays. This allows for precise data representation and manipulation. The strict type system helps prevent many common programming errors.

Control Structures

Pascal offers a comprehensive range of control structures such as if-then-else statements, for loops, while loops, and repeat-until loops. These structures enable programmers to control the flow of execution effectively.

Procedures and Functions

Procedures and functions are fundamental building blocks in Pascal. They encapsulate reusable code blocks, promoting modularity and reducing redundancy. They also help improve code organization and readability.

Advantages of Using Pascal

  • Readability: Pascal's syntax is designed for clarity, making it easier to read and understand. This is particularly beneficial for beginners learning programming.
  • Structured Approach: The emphasis on structured programming leads to well-organized and maintainable code. This is crucial for large projects.
  • Strong Typing: Pascal's strict type system helps catch errors early in the development process. This improves code reliability.
  • Educational Value: Pascal is often used in educational settings to teach fundamental programming concepts. Its clear structure simplifies the learning process.

Disadvantages of Pascal

  • Limited Libraries: Compared to modern languages, Pascal has a relatively smaller standard library. This can limit its capabilities in certain domains.
  • Less Popular: Pascal's popularity has waned over the years, resulting in a smaller community and fewer readily available resources.
  • Less Versatile: It isn't as widely adaptable to different programming paradigms as some modern languages. Its strengths are in structured programming, but it lacks the flexibility of others.

Modern Applications of Pascal

Despite its reduced popularity, Pascal still finds application in specific niches:

  • Education: It continues to be used as a teaching language in many universities and colleges. It remains a strong foundation for learning programming concepts.
  • Embedded Systems: Pascal's efficiency and structured approach make it suitable for programming embedded systems, although other languages are often preferred now.
  • Legacy Systems: Many older systems were built using Pascal, requiring ongoing maintenance and updates. This ensures that Pascal knowledge remains relevant in some fields.
  • Specific Niche Applications: Certain specialized applications might still utilize Pascal due to its suitability for specific tasks or existing codebases.

How Does Pascal Compare to Other Languages?

Pascal's structured approach contrasts with the more flexible, object-oriented nature of languages like C++, Java, or C#. While Python offers similar readability, it lacks Pascal's strict typing. This comparison highlights the different design philosophies and strengths of these various languages.
